Name | Oishii Japan |
---|---|
Address | 1233 W Rancho Vista Blvd #803, Palmdale, CA 93551, United States |
City | Palmdale Ca |
Category | Japanese Restaurants |
Phone | |
Email ID | |
Website |
Following are the list of some other best Japanese Restaurants In Palmdale Ca United States
3135 Rancho Vista Boulevard, Suite #G, Palmdale, CA 93551
39409 10th Street West, Suite A, Palmdale, CA 93551
39409 10th St W ste a, Palmdale, CA 93551, United States
2728 E Palmdale Blvd #116, Palmdale, CA 93550, United States